Ingredients

The following ingredients have 6 Servings
  • 1/2 pound lean ground beef
  • 1/2 pound Italian pork sausage
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1/4 cup diced carrots (about 2 carrots)
  • 1/4 cup diced celery (about 2 stalks)
  • 1/4 cup minced onion (1bout 1/2 onion)
  • 3 to 4 cloves minced garlic
  • 3/4 cup red wine
  • 1 1/2 cups diced or strained tomatoes
  • a pinch of nutmeg
  • 1 bay leaf
  • freshly grated Parmesan cheese for sprinkling
  • 1/4 cup whole milk or light cream

Instruction

  • Heat a cast-iron pan or dutch oven over medium heat.
  • Add the onions, garlic, carrots, and celery - cook stirring occasionally until they begin to soften which will take about 6 to 8 minutes.
  • Add the ground beef and sausage to the pan and for 8 to 10 minutes until it's almost cooked through.
  • Gradually add the wine in intervals, allowing it to evaporate before adding more.
  • Stir in the tomatoes, nutmeg, and bay leaf. Reduce the heat to low and let it simmer for an hour on very low heat.
  • Remove the bay leaf and stir in the milk. Cover the pan loosely and simmer for 20 minutes longer and serve over your favorite pasta.
